Notable Jam Chart Performances

Individual jam chart entries from this venue:

1994-11-14 David Bowie (25:50) Set 2 Noteworthy
3rd "Big" '94 "Bowie." One of the most exploratory and improvisational versions ever. Includes some wild and crazy interaction with the audience.

1994-11-14 Maze (11:44) Set 1
Fish gets the intensity so cranked up during Page's turn that Trey only needs a match to blow this one up. Instead, he adds the flame thrower.
1994-11-14 Cavern (5:34) Set 1
> "Lawn Boy", this fun and spirited version retains elements of the Page "standard", resulting in a unique mashup of sorts while, at times, radically altering "Cavern's" set composition.
